The breeding conditions of the maidenhair fernThe conditions for the reproduction of maidenhair fern spores are undoubtedly high temperature and high humidity. Ferns cultivated under such conditions are more likely to survive and bloom. Maidenhair fern soilThe substrate is the culture soil for spore reproduction. Peat and fine sand can be evenly mixed and disinfected, and then the substrate can be placed in a shallow pot. Selection of maidenhair fern leavesCut the leaves with mature spores and spread them evenly in a shallow basin with culture soil. There is no need to cover them with soil. If you really don't want to, you can cover them with a very thin layer of culture soil, but don't submerge the spore leaves in the soil. Maintenance of the maidenhair fernAfter sowing, cover the pot with glass or plastic wrap, and then soak water in the basin to ensure that its living environment has enough moisture. Pay attention to ventilation. Remove the glass or replace the plastic wrap for ventilation after one or two days of planting to avoid rotting.
